Haerts – Days Go By

Singer Nini Fabi and multi-instrumentalist Benny Gebert are originally from Munich. They met in high school and became a couple, both romantically and musically. The two have been living in the United States for years now. First in New York, but they recently relocated to California. Originally, their band Haerts was a quartet, but in 2021, Fabi and Gebert are the two remaining core members. However, the band can grow out to a six-piece when playing live.

Dream Nation, out this week, is the outfitโ€™s third album. Once again a collection of gorgeous, ethereal alt-pop music, with clear nods to the โ€˜60s and โ€˜70s. Take new single Days Go By, for instance. A lovely retro pop song with jazz and soul influences. Itโ€™s got an exotic touch, thanks to tropical drums, a prominent flute and even a lovely house piano. It reminds me of The Brand New Heavies, which is never a bad thing!
